// Fixture: simulates a cold start of the Quillfire order handler.
// New folks: cold starts here mean the warm cache is empty, so the
// handler re-fetches config from Lanternmesh on first invoke. That's
// why the first assertion allows 3s instead of 300ms. The mock
// Lanternmesh server expects auth, so the fixture injects the bearer
// token shown below.

session JWT of yawep-yawep = eyJhbGciOiJIUzI1NiIsInR5cCI6IkpXVCJ9.eyJzdWIiOiI3pWF3_In0.aXYsHiog

- [ ] Step 7: Archive cold storage buckets (Glacierline tier). Confirm both ceremony witnesses are present, verify bucket manifests match the Oxbow ledger, then seal the archive key shares. Plugin authors may observe but not handle shares. Once sealed, the archive index itself is encrypted and can only be reopened with the passphrase below.

vault phrase of badup-hahig = tamael-aldael-kelmir-istael-fenok-istwyn-tamius-jorath-oliion

Future maintainers: we finally retuned the read-replica lag alarm on Quornberry's reporting cluster. The old 5-second threshold paged someone basically every backup window, and everyone had learned to ignore it — which is how we missed the real lag incident in the spring. The alarm now uses a sustained-lag window instead of instantaneous samples, and the warn/critical split gives you time to react before queries go stale. Don't lower these without reading the incident retro. The new default configuration values are listed below.

service settings:
[casax]
port = 6379
team = rusir
host = casax.zemvarhq.corp
region = outer-4
access_code = ac_9808ce
timeout_ms = 1500